Remote Pay Bands Explained

RF engineers face unique remote work challenges due to hardware dependencies, but many companies now offer location-adjusted compensation models. Engineers in San Francisco or Seattle typically earn 15-25% more than those in Austin or Denver, while fully remote positions often target the 75th percentile of national salary ranges. Companies like Qualcomm and Broadcom have implemented tiered geographic pay scales that account for local cost of living while maintaining competitive compensation.

The trend toward hybrid work has created new negotiation opportunities for RF engineers, with many companies offering 'hub premiums' for occasional lab access combined with remote flexibility. When negotiating remote compensation, emphasize your ability to perform design work, simulations, and documentation remotely while being available for critical lab sessions. Companies increasingly value engineers who can maintain productivity across distributed teams and mentor junior staff virtually.

Moving from high-cost metros like San Jose ($180K average) to lower-cost areas like Raleigh ($135K average) while maintaining remote work can dramatically improve purchasing power - effectively increasing real compensation by 20-30%. A $160K remote salary in Austin provides similar lifestyle benefits to $200K+ in Silicon Valley, while maintaining access to top-tier RF engineering opportunities and career advancement paths.

How to Negotiate Your Offer

Practical steps that move the number without damaging the relationship.

Start your ask above the median. You'll rarely be offered more than you ask, so anchor high and let the employer negotiate you down.

Say 'market data puts this role at $X–$Y' — not 'I was hoping for more'. External benchmarks are harder to argue against than personal expectations.

When base is stuck, negotiate equity vesting schedule, signing bonus, or accelerated refresh grants. Total comp has more levers than base alone.

Ask for 48 hours to review. This creates time to counter and signals that you take offers seriously — not that you are uncertain.
